第九次作业

1

#include<stdio.h>

#include<stdlib.h>

#include<time.h>

int main(){

       int a,b,c;

       srand((unsigned)time(NULL));

       a=rand();

       b=a%100;

       while(b!=c)

       {

              printf("请输入一个0--99的数字:");

              scanf("%d",&c);

              if(b<c)

                     printf("大了点!\n");

              if(b>c)

                     printf("小了点!\n");

       }

       printf("你猜中了!\n");

}

 

2

 

#include<stdio.h>

main(){

 int i,a=1;float sum=0;

 for(i=1;i<=100;i++)

 {

  sum+=a*1.0/i;a=-a;

 

 }

 printf("sum=%f\n",sum);

}

 

3

#include<stdio.h>

main(){

       int s=0,n,b=0,a;

       printf("请输入一个整数");

              scanf("%d",&n);

       for(a=1;a<=n;a++)

       {

              s+=a;

                     b+=5;

       }

       printf("%d",b);

}

 

4

#include<stdio.h>

main(){

        long x;

        int temp=0,num=0;

        printf("请输入一个整数:\n");

        scanf("%ld",&x);

        printf("它的每一位数字是:\n");

        while(x>0)

        {

              printf("%3d",x%10);

              temp=temp*10+x%10;

              x=x/10;

              num++;

         }

         printf("\n它是一个%d位数.\n",num);

         printf("它的逆序是:d\n",temp);

}

 

posted @ 2021-11-15 22:01  拾柒^  阅读(16)  评论(0)    收藏  举报